Ingredients:

2 chicken breasts
1 head of cauliflower, cut into florets
1 head of broccoli, cut into florets
2 tablespoons olive oil
Salt and pepper to taste
2 tablespoons tahini
2 tablespoons lemon juice
1 tablespoon honey
2 tablespoons water

Cooking Instructions:

Preheat oven to 400°F.
Place cauliflower and broccoli florets on a baking sheet and drizzle with olive oil. Season with salt and pepper.
Roast in the oven for 20 minutes, stirring halfway through.
Meanwhile, heat a grill pan over medium-high heat.
Season chicken breasts with salt and pepper and grill for 5-7 minutes per side, or until cooked through.
In a small bowl, whisk together tahini, lemon juice, honey, and water.
To assemble the salad, place roasted cauliflower and broccoli on a plate. Top with grilled chicken and drizzle with lemon tahini dressing.
